Biernath et al. concluded that phenolic novolac and epoxidized cresol novolac cure reactions using triphenylphosphine as the catalyst had a short initiation period wherein the concentration of phenolate ion increased, followed by a (steady-state) propagation regime where the number of reactive phenolate species was constant.85 The epoxy ring opening was reportedly first order in the steady-state regime. [Pg.413]

If we seek a strictly steady detonation propagation regime in which the entire phenomenon moves in space with a single specific and constant velocity, it is obvious that the shock wave igniting the gas must satisfy one and only one condition—it must propagate in the gas with the same velocity as that of the detonation. [Pg.425]

Within the region of optimal experimental parameters, the combustion wave velocity remains constant and the temperature profile T(t) has the same form at each point of the reaction medium. This regime is called steady propagation of the combustion synthesis wave, or steady SHS process. As the reaction conditions move away from the optimum, where the heat evolution decreases and/or heat losses increase, different types of unsteady propagation regimes have been observed. Based on the DSC and microdielectrometry studies, the kinetics of the TPP catalyzed epoiy-phenol reaction can be described through an initiation regime and a "steady state" propagation regime. Diffusion limitations do not appear to have substantial influence within the temperature range of interest. [Pg.142]

The sensitivity of nitroglycerol decreases with temperature. However, frozen it is sensitive to friction due to inteicrystalline contact. It decomposes above 60 °C. It exhibits a low-velocity propagation regime with a detonation rate of about 2000 m/s compared with its high-eneigy detonation rate of about 7800 m/s. [Pg.90]
